Role Summary

Role Summary We have an exciting role within the Research & Development Office for a Sponsorship Project Team Manager (Band 7).

This post is an integral part of the R&D Division's core function which exists to provide an efficient support service to deliver research sponsored by the Trust.

We are looking for an enthusiastic individual with postgraduate degree qualification (or equivalent experience) to support research undertaken by The Royal Devon University Healthcare NHS Foundation Trust. The primary purpose of this role is to be responsible for guidance at all stages of the research grant submission process using expert knowledge in accordance with Research Department procedures, Research Governance and legislative requirements and the post-award management of research grants. These awards cover a range of funding sources which include NIHR, Research Councils, Industry, and UK Charities.

Main duties of the job

The post holder is to

  • manage, co-ordinate and develop systems and robust processes to ensure that grants are submitted according to sponsor requirements and standards
  • have expert knowledge in research governance
  • a good understanding of AcoRD guidance
  • lead a team of R&D facilitators, responsible for the regulatory approval of successful grants
  • build and maintain strong relationships with researchers and key external collaborators
